06/8/2013 09:22 | LONDON--House prices in the U.K. rose at their fastest annual rate for almost three years in July, mortgage lender Halifax said Tuesday, in a further sign Britain's economic recovery is gathering pace. Halifax, a unit of Lloyds Banking Group PLC (LLOY.LN), said house prices rose 4.6% in July compared with a year earlier, the largest annual increase since August 2010. Prices rose 0.9% between June and July to an average of 169,624 pounds ($259,786), the lender said. | doodlebug4 | |

Taylor Wimpey yesterday hailed a 'meaningful improvement' in the housing market as demand for new homes hit a record high. The builder, which has benefited from Government schemes to support homebuyers such as Funding for Lending and Help to Buy, said it has orders for 7,378 homes worth £1.3billion on its books. It came as it reported an 11.1 per cent rise in sales for the first half of the year to £1billion and a 42.1 per cent jump in profits to £109m as it sold more homes at higher prices. Rightmove, Britain's most visited property website, provided further evidence that the housing market is on the mend with a 16 per cent rise in half-year revenues to £67.2m and a 15 per cent increase in profits to £44.6m. Taylor Wimpey chief executive Pete Redfern (pictured) said: 'During the first half of 2013, there has been a meaningful improvement in the housing market, with more positive consumer sentiment, a more available and affordable mortgage market, and the presence of government schemes all adding to the favourable outlook.' He said around 1,300 newly built homes have been reserved under the Help to Buy initiative which offers government loans to house-hunters with small deposits. | doodlebug4 | |
